The Opportunity
Berkshire Talent Partnership is recruiting for an experienced Mechanical Project Engineer on behalf of our client, a leading player in the UK’s energy infrastructure sector. This is a 12-month contract role, working on high-profile projects in renewable energy, gas peaking, and energy storage.
You’ll be at the heart of the project delivery process — managing design reviews, coordinating with multidisciplinary teams, and ensuring every stage meets strict safety, quality, and performance standards.
What You’ll Be Doing
- Manage your own workload to deliver against project design specifications, budgets, and timelines.
- Collaborate with designers, contractors, project managers, planners, and procurement teams to develop and execute project plans.
- Conduct site assessments to evaluate feasibility and gather technical requirements.
- Oversee the installation, testing, and commissioning of mechanical systems, ensuring compliance with safety and regulatory standards.
- Review design developments with suppliers, taking documentation through IFC (Issue for Construction) and IAB (Issue As Built) stages.
- Support site teams in resolving TQs and NCRs, liaising with PMs and procurement on solutions.
- Participate in risk reviews, lessons learned sessions, and project reporting.
- Represent the company in meetings with contractors and design teams.
- Provide input to the project’s Health & Safety file and ensure residual risks are actively managed.
What We’re Looking For
- Experience: 5–10 years in renewables, energy generation, or similar (e.g., gas peaking, energy storage, wind, solar), with a strong track record in construction project delivery.
- Qualifications: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ering (or related field).
- Technical Skills: Broad mechanical engineering knowledge, including civil and electrical interfaces.
- Bonus Skills: Knowledge of gas peaking plant construction, AutoCAD 2D, Navisworks, SMSTS or CSCS certification.
- Personal Qualities: Excellent attention to detail, clear communicator, and confident relationship-builder with both office and site-based teams.
